The most effective way to clean engine carbon deposits starts with prevention. Having driven for over a decade, I know carbon buildup is dirty residue from incomplete fuel combustion that affects power and fuel efficiency. First, I recommend using high-quality gasoline with fewer impurities for cleaner burning; change engine oil regularly without delay; occasionally take the car on highways to maintain high RPMs and help burn off some deposits. For existing carbon buildup, fuel additives are super convenient—just pour some bought from the supermarket into the tank and drive to dissolve part of it. But remember, severe carbon deposits require professional intake system cleaning at a shop for better results. Preventing carbon buildup also extends engine life—I ask mechanics to check deposits during my biannual maintenance, as forming good habits is key. Don’t underestimate it; excessive buildup makes cold starts difficult.

As a seasoned car enthusiast, I trust professional methods for carbon deposit cleaning the most, but high cost is the pain point. Disassembling the engine for physical cleaning delivers the most thorough results. Last time my car had idle vibration, it ran smoothly after a shop cleaning. For mild carbon buildup, driving at high speeds works quite well—I intentionally drove at high RPM for 30 minutes during a long trip to save money and effort. Additives are also decent; adding a bottle monthly helps maintain cleanliness. When carbon deposits are severe, sudden acceleration can worsen the problem, so smooth driving is recommended. Key point: Carbon deposits can affect emissions and even damage the catalytic converter, so early treatment saves money in the long run. For prevention, use full synthetic oil—don’t skimp on that small expense. My experience proves that good oil keeps the engine running beautifully even after 100,000 kilometers.

Effectively cleaning carbon deposits depends on the severity. I've tried various methods. Professional disassembly and cleaning are perfect but time-consuming and costly; fuel additives are simple—just pour into the tank and drive—suitable for most people; high-speed driving is free but has limited effect. I recommend trying additives first, and if ineffective, then opt for professional repair—cost-effective and efficient. Carbon deposits may cause engine shaking and increased fuel consumption, so regular maintenance checks can prevent worsening. From a practical standpoint, prevention is better than cure: use high-quality gasoline and avoid prolonged idling.

What does 'service' mean on a car?

Service on a car refers to maintenance, which is a reminder function set by the manufacturer to alert the owner to perform scheduled maintenance at specific mileage intervals as needed. After maintenance is completed, it needs to be reset following a certain procedure. Car maintenance refers to the preventive work of regularly inspecting, cleaning, replenishing, lubricating, adjusting, or replacing certain parts of the vehicle, also known as car servicing. Modern car maintenance mainly includes the maintenance of the engine system, transmission system, air conditioning system, cooling system, fuel system, power steering system, etc. The purpose of car maintenance is to keep the vehicle clean and tidy, maintain normal technical conditions, eliminate potential hazards, prevent faults, slow down the deterioration process, and extend the service life.

What are the length, width, and height of the Camry?

The length, width, and height dimensions of the Camry are 4900mm/1840mm/1455mm, which are official data. The length of the Camry refers to the distance between two vertical lines perpendicular to the vehicle's longitudinal symmetry plane and touching the outermost protruding points at the front and rear of the car. The width refers to the distance between two planes parallel to the vehicle's longitudinal symmetry plane and touching the outermost rigid fixed protruding points on both sides of the vehicle. The height refers to the distance between the highest point of the vehicle and its supporting plane. The Camry's naturally aspirated engine delivers a maximum power of 154kW and a maximum torque of 250Nm. This engine reaches its maximum power at 6600 rpm and its maximum torque at 5000 rpm. It is equipped with hybrid injection technology and features an aluminum alloy cylinder head and block. This engine is pa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ission. National regulations specify vehicle dimensions. According to the national standard 'GB1589-89,' the total width of a vehicle excludes side mirrors. The limitation on vehicle width is designed to provide sufficient lateral clearance for overtaking between adjacent lanes. This means that, under national standards, the significance of vehicle width data lies in ensuring adequate space during overtaking, preventing accidents due to excessive width or situations where road markings are narrower than the vehicle's width. Additionally, national regulations stipulate that the total width of a vehicle must not exceed 2.5m to meet the requirements of public road usage.

How to Handle Crosswinds While Driving

When encountering crosswinds while driving, the following methods should be adopted: 1. Firmly grip the steering wheel: When hit by crosswinds, the vehicle's direction may deviate, and tire traction can be affected. At this point, apply slight force in the direction of the wind to maintain the correct driving path. 2. Avoid slamming on the brakes: When pushed by strong winds, the vehicle's center of gravity becomes unstable. You should ease off the accelerator and gently apply the brakes to slow down, helping the tires regain traction. Simultaneously, gauge the wind's intensity and make corresponding adjustments with the steering wheel. Crosswinds are strong winds that blow from the side of the vehicle, often making the tires feel like they have insufficient grip, as if a powerful force is pulling the car sideways, which can easily lead to skidding or rollovers.

How to Remove the ETC from the Car?

Methods to remove the ETC from the car: 1. Prepare a fishing line; 2. Wear a pair of rubber gloves; 3. Straighten the fishing line with both hands and pull it down forcefully from the ETC. If it's stuck too tightly, pull several times and use the fishing line to cut through back and forth; 4. After cutting, clean the residue on the windshield with a wet wipe. ETC (Electronic Toll Collection) is an automatic toll collection system for highways or bridges. It uses dedicated short-range communication between the vehicle-mounted electronic tag installed on the windshield and the microwave antenna in the ETC lane at the toll station. Through computer networking technology and bank back-end settlement processing, it achieves the purpose of vehicles passing through highway or bridge toll stations without stopping to pay tolls.

Does the FAW Toyota IZOA comply with China VI emission standards?

FAW Toyota IZOA complies with China VI emission standards. The vehicle is equipped with Toyota's new 2.0L engine, delivering a maximum power of 171 horsepower and peak torque of 205 Nm, with a compression ratio of 13:1 and thermal efficiency as high as 40%. It is paired with Toyota's Direct Shift CVT continuously variable transmission. FAW Toyota IZOA is FAW Toyota's first TNGA (Toyota New Global Architecture) concept SUV, with body dimensions of 4405mm in length, 1795mm in width, and 1565mm in height, a wheelbase of 2640mm, a top speed of 185 km/h, and a whole vehicle warranty period of 3 years or 100,000 kilometers.
